Italy - Live Fish Gross Imports
Since 2014, Italy Live Fish Gross Imports decreased by 1.8% year on year. With $23,885,413.2 in 2019, the country was ranked number 10 among other countries in Live Fish Gross Imports. Italy is overtaken by Belgium, which was ranked number 9 with $28,285,044.06 and is followed by Vietnam at $23,369,454.93. Japan ranked the highest with $507,114,277.86 in 2019, a decrease of 12.7% compared to 2018. South Korea, China and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Indonesia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+102% per year, while Philippines recorded the worst performance at -75.5% per year.
